Mrs. Gouger, the wife of the late John Gouger, was the daughter of the late John and Catherine Arch and was born Aug 31, 1862, at Henry, IL. She came to Iowa from Illinois from Illinois at the age of 14 and was married here to John Gouger. They resided on their farm southwest of Jefferson, where they reared their family of three sons. One year was spent at Chariton and 13 years ago they moved to Eagle Grove to live.
Mr. Gouger passed away in 1933 and a son, Ed, died in 1918.
Mrs. Gouger is survived by two sons, Wylie of Des Moines and Ray of Scranton; a brother, Ed Arch of Scranton; five grandchildren: Mrs. Helen Young of Wichita Falls, Texas, Keith S. of Los Angeles, Cal., John S. of Jefferson, Margaret of Eagle Grove and Mary Em of Des Moines, and two great grandchildren, the children of Keith S. Gouger in Los Angeles.
